I intend to be a lifelong student, interested in various fields such as business management, event planning, organizational behavior, and health.  I'm very active in the meeting and event industry, and still work with my alma mater, University of Delaware, to help students learn more about the industry.

My day job is a Meeting Manager for Produce Marketing Association, which is a Trade Association for the entire produce industry (Field to Fork). I work with a team of people to plan our annual convention and tradeshow, Fresh Summit, as well as, a golf tournament, leadership symposium, international events, and other regional events. I'm also on the Board of Directors for the Greater Philadelphia Chapter of PCMA, and I'm a student at University of Delaware pursuing my MBA and a M.S in Organizational, Effectiveness, Development, and Change.
